UKRAINE GOVERNANCE ASSESSMENT
SIGMA (Support for Improvement in Governance and Management) is a joint initiative of the European Union (EU) and the Organisation for Economic Cooperation and Development (OECD), principally financed by the EU (www.sigmaweb.org)
In all countries SIGMA aimed at:
- assist beneficiary countries in their search for good governance to improveadministrative efficiency and promote adherence of public sector staff todemocratic values, ethics and respect of the rule of law;
- help build up indigenous capacities at the central governmental level to facethe challenges of globalisation and of European Union integration plans;
- support initiatives of the European Union and other donors to assistbeneficiary countries in public administration reform.
At the request of the Ukrainian government, with the financial support of DFID (the UK Department for International Development), SIDA (the Swedish International Development Agency) and upon the endorsement of the European Commission, SIGMA carried out governance assessment in Ukraine at the beginning of 2006. The assessment was developed according to SIGMA’s competence, methodology and baselines that are usually used to assess public administration in candidate countries.
A final report was delivered in March 2006, and its main conclusions were presented at an international conference “Strategy of Administrating the Reform: SIGMA Recommendations to the Ukraine’s Government” held in Kiev in July 2006. In 2007, SIGMA presented an updated report.
In 2008, the European Commission decided to allow the countries covered by the European Neighborhood Policy to use an institution building instrument of European Commission, SIGMA, in 2008-2011. Active use of this opportunity by Ukraine will enable to engage leading European experts to the adaptation of administrative legislation and administrative justice, cost management, control, internal and external audit, procurement, civil service, policy coordination and regulatory management to the standards of the European Union.
